Petrology and Age of the Pre-Otavi Basement Granite at Franzfontein, Northern South-West Africa

Abstract:Chemical, spectrographic, and isotopic analyses are presentedfor the Franzfontein alkali granite and constituent minerals.This rock has the chemical character of granties produced byliquid {rightleftharpoons} crystal equilibrium. Dated at 1, 700?70m.y. by the constituentzircon, its crystallization formed part of a major period (theHuabian episode) of batholithic granite emplacement in northernSouth-West Africa. The occurrence of these crystalline rocksin the core of the Huab anticline defines the maximum possibleage of the overlying Otavi Facies sediments, precluding theircorrelation with the Transvaal System of South Africa. The imprint of the Damara metamorphism (Damaran episode) isreflected in the Sr/Rb age (560?30 m.y.) obtained for the biotite:the inversion of biotite to stilpnomelane and chlorite probablyrepresents the mineralogical effects of that metamorphis. Isotopicdata indicate that changes in the relative concentrations ofRb and Sr differed significantly in plagioclase and microcline;such data from feldspars in metamorphic rocks should, therefore,be interpreted with caution.
